363.21 (Exhibit) - INTERNET SAFETY AND ACCEPTABLE USE
STUDENT USER AGREEMENT & PARENT PERMISSION FORM

As a user of the School District of Auburndale computers for Internet access, I hereby agree to comply with the district’s Internet Safety and Acceptable Use Policy – communicating over the network in a responsible fashion while honoring all relevant laws and restrictions. I understand that failure to comply with the policy may result in loss of Internet access and other disciplinary or legal actions.

Student Name (printed): _________________________________

Student’s Signature: ___________________________________ Date: ________________


As the parent or legal guardian of the student signing above, I grant permission for my son or daughter to access the Internet via the district network. I understand that this access is designed to enhance the curriculum and learning opportunities for students in the district. I understand that the School District of Auburndale has taken precautions to prevent access to inappropriate or harmful material, however, I recognize it is impossible for the district to control access to all objectionable material or the Internet. Therefore, I accept the responsibility for setting and conveying standards that my son or daughter should follow when selecting, sharing, or exploring information and media on the Internet. I understand that individuals and families may be held liable for actions taken on the Internet and that failure of my son or daughter to comply with the district’s Internet Safety and Acceptable Use Policy may result in loss of Internet access and other disciplinary or legal action.
